]> git.lyx.org Git - lyx.git/commitdiff
Add Preview to ERT context menu
authorPavel Sanda <sanda@lyx.org>
Sun, 28 Mar 2010 20:12:24 +0000 (20:12 +0000)
committerPavel Sanda <sanda@lyx.org>
Sun, 28 Mar 2010 20:12:24 +0000 (20:12 +0000)
git-svn-id: svn://svn.lyx.org/lyx/lyx-devel/trunk@33895 a592a061-630c-0410-9148-cb99ea01b6c8

lib/ui/stdcontext.inc
src/insets/InsetERT.h

index 583e49eb1608867f973e62efd7a747cc8fc1dba3..79e242eb3ca12e50468667673b84159e1fce6e92 100644 (file)
@@ -622,4 +622,17 @@ Menuset
                Item "Select Section|S" "section-select"
        End     
 
+#
+# InsetERT context menu
+#
+       Menu "context-ert"
+               OptItem "Open Inset|O" "inset-toggle open"
+               OptItem "Close Inset|C" "inset-toggle close"
+               Separator
+               Item "Wrap by Preview|P" "command-sequence inset-begin;char-backward;char-forward-select;preview-insert"
+               Separator
+               Item "Dissolve Inset|D" "inset-dissolve"
+               OptItem "Settings...|S" "inset-settings"
+       End
+
 End
index 2839af02ff069a0a5e7e878fbdf0266d167e83a4..139834c21aec6f2ff178ca17238505d04fb1cfa0 100644 (file)
@@ -37,6 +37,9 @@ public:
        static CollapseStatus string2params(std::string const &);
        ///
        static std::string params2string(CollapseStatus);
+
+       docstring contextMenu(BufferView const &, int, int) const
+               { return from_ascii("context-ert"); }
 private:
        ///
        InsetCode lyxCode() const { return ERT_CODE; }